TATIANA CALDERON Out as Gradient Racing Swaps Drivers for IMSA Finale

- TATIANA CALDERON has been replaced by Mason Filippi at Gradient Racing for the final two IMSA WeatherTech SportsCar Championship rounds at Indianapolis and Petit Le Mans, ending her stint in the team’s Michelin Endurance Cup program.
- Team owner Andris Laivins thanked CALDERON for being “a great part of the Gradient family” and promised to look for future racing opportunities together, suggesting this change wasn’t performance-related but rather a strategic move for the season finale.
- Filippi will make his GTD class debut in Gradient’s No. 66 Ford Mustang GT3 alongside Joey Hand and Till Bechtolsheimer, having impressed the team during recent testing and earned this promotion from his successful Michelin Pilot Challenge campaign.
